AUSTRALIAN'S 'GIVING' EXPECTATIONS!

In a recent article release by Giving Australia called "Researching Philanthropy: Summary of Early Findings" the following points were highlighted about the giving' expectations of businesses and individuals.

In summary Businesses state:

a

The Not for Profit (NFP) organisation needs to be more transparent and accountable

a

NFP's need to provide relevant feedback about their contribution

a

Businesses want opportunities of volunteering for their staff (particularly larger businesses)

a

Tax incentives are not a major motivation

a

Business want workplace giving opportunities for individual choice by employees [grass roots] (particularly larger businesses)

a

Business wants to give to local causes.

 

In summary Individuals state;

a

Giving reflects their life values

a

They don't like aggressive marketing (telemarketing)

a

Givers prefer giving to 'needy and innocent'

a

Noted that feedback was rare, but reinforcing of their giving

a

Gave on spontaneous or convenient grounds (from the heart), not planned

a

Wanted local causes

a

High net worth/high income givers valued privacy and tax incentives
